A Phase 2, Open-Label, Randomized, Cross-Over Study of Regadenoson in Subjects Undergoing Stress Myocardial Perfusion Imaging by Multidetector Computed Tomography (MDCT) and Single Photon Emission Computed Tomography (SPECT)
In Brief
A Phase 2 clinical trial evaluating regadenoson, technetium Tc99m sestamibi /technetium Tc99m tetrafosmin, and 3 other interventions for Coronary Artery Disease (CAD). Completed, enrolled 124 participants across 11 sites.
Detailed Summary
The purpose of this study is to compare Multidetector Computed Tomography (MDCT) and Single Photon Emission Computed Tomography (SPECT) stress myocardial perfusion imaging (MPI) with regadenoson in order to detect the presence or absence of reversible defects.
